Transaction f76423ae7b21452c82b4a910633bced86a3bf54859613efef763745d0d9d3b80

4 Input
2 Outputs
  • f76423ae7b21452c82b4a910633bced86a3bf54859613efef763745d0d9d3b80:0
  • value  12000000
    address  3Hp2fzJsFZ7AGjZko6NXJiYipcr6doGPvz
  • f76423ae7b21452c82b4a910633bced86a3bf54859613efef763745d0d9d3b80:1
  • value  41640
    address  3BMEXCDqaaH5ThJCLydrWnFnuq9Y5ujEw4